Padang weather in February

In February, Padang sees average daytime highs of 28°C and overnight lows near 26°C, with 262 mm of rain across 19.9 wet days and about 12 hours of daylight. It is the 3rd-warmest and 10th-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 28°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 5% of the time in February, and the air most often feels oppressive.

Daylight stretches from about 12 hours at the start of February to 12 hours by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, February is Padang's 5th-clearest and 7th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Padang's year-round climate.

Location & terrain

Where is Padang?

Padang sits at 0.9°S, 100.4°E, 6 m above sea level, in Indonesia. The nearest listed city is Solok, 38 km away.

Topography around Padang

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Padang.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Padang has signific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 315 m around an average of 15 m above sea level; within 16 km, very signific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 1,310 m; within 80 km, extreme vari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 2,877 m.

The land around Padang is covered by water (46%) and artificial surfaces (39%) within 3 km, water (51%) and trees (34%) within 16 km, and trees (55%) and water (39%) within 80 km.
